AptarGroup Reports All-Time High Quarterly Results; Boosts Dividend 33 Percent

    CRYSTAL LAKE, Ill.--(BUSINESS WIRE)--July 20, 2005--AptarGroup, Inc.
(NYSE:ATR) today reported record quarter results and declared an
increased quarterly dividend.

    SECOND QUARTER RESULTS

    For the quarter ended June 30, 2005, sales increased 14 percent to
a record $356.1 million from $311.8 million in the prior year. Sales
excluding changes in foreign currency exchange rates increased
approximately 11 percent from the prior year. Net income for the
second quarter of 2005 increased to a record $29.3 million from $22.8
million a year ago. Diluted earnings per share increased 33 percent to
$.81 per share compared to $.61 per share in the prior year. Net
income for the second quarter included reduced income taxes of
approximately $3.2 million ($.09 per diluted share) related to
research and development credits in the U.S. and tax changes in Italy.

    SIX MONTHS RESULTS

    For the six months ended June 30, 2005, sales increased 12 percent
to a record $700.1 million from $627.4 million in the prior year.
Sales excluding changes in foreign currency exchange rates increased
approximately 8 percent from the prior year. Net income for the first
six months of 2005, including the second quarter tax benefits
described above, increased to a record $51.4 million from $44.0
million a year ago. Diluted earnings per share increased 19 percent to
$1.41 per share compared to $1.18 per share in the prior year.

    MANAGEMENT COMMENT

    Commenting on the quarter, Carl A. Siebel, President and Chief
Executive Officer, said, "We are pleased to report that we continued
to build on the momentum we experienced in the first quarter. We
achieved a record level of quarterly sales as a result of strong
demand for our products from the personal care, pharmaceutical,
household and food/beverage markets. Sales to the fragrance/cosmetic
market slowed in the quarter and were approximately equal to the prior
year's level."
    Siebel added, "With increased volumes, we were able to leverage
our infrastructure and realize operating efficiencies. In addition, we
were successful in passing through the majority of our raw material
cost increases. These factors contributed to our record earnings per
share."

    BUSINESS SEGMENT PERFORMANCE

    For the quarter, sales of the Dispensing Systems segment increased
12 percent, to $294.5 million from $261.9 million in the prior year.
The increase is mainly due to increased sales to the personal care,
pharmaceutical and food/beverage markets and changes in exchange
rates. For the first six months, sales increased 10 percent to $575.8
million from $524.1 million in the prior year. Dispensing Systems
segment income (income before interest expense in excess of interest
income, corporate expenses, income taxes and unusual items) increased
to $39.7 million from $35.0 million in the prior year. For the first
six months, Dispensing Systems segment income increased to $71.8
million from $66.3 million in the prior year.
    For the quarter, sales of the SeaquistPerfect segment increased 23
percent, to $64.2 million from $52.1 million in the prior year. The
increase is due to improved sales to the personal care and household
markets and the inclusion of sales from EP Spray System SA, which was
acquired in the first quarter of this year. For the first six months,
sales increased 20 percent to $129.6 million from $107.8 million in
the prior year. Second quarter SeaquistPerfect segment income
increased to $6.3 million from $4.8 million a year ago. For the first
six months, SeaquistPerfect segment income increased to $13.1 million
from $10.1 million in the prior year.

    OUTLOOK

    Siebel commented, "We are optimistic that the trends we have
experienced in the second quarter will continue into the third
quarter. At the present time, we believe demand for our dispensing
systems from all of the markets we serve, other than the
fragrance/cosmetic market, will improve over prior year levels. In
addition, we plan to reduce and redeploy certain personnel at our
French fragrance/cosmetic operations. We plan to implement this
program over a three year period and we expect to realize cost savings
over time. Anticipated charges related to the first phase of this
effort will be approximately $3 million in the second half of 2005 and
will be recorded in the quarter in which they are recognizable for
accounting purposes."
    Siebel concluded, "Excluding any effects of this program, we
expect diluted earnings per share for the third quarter of 2005 to be
in the range of $.70 to $.75 compared to $.68 per share in the prior
year."

    CASH DIVIDEND INCREASE

    The Board of Directors increased the quarterly dividend to $.20
per share, payable August 23, 2005 to shareholders of record as of
August 2, 2005. This represents a 33 percent increase over the
previous quarterly dividend of $.15 per share. Siebel commented, "Our
Board continues to evaluate ways to enhance shareholder value. While
we want to maintain flexibility to pursue opportunities that could
contribute to our growth, we also recognize that our strong financial
position and cash generating ability allow us to return value to
shareholders in the form of dividends. This increase, which follows
last year's doubling of the dividend, is a clear indication of our
commitment to our shareholders and our confidence in our business."

    SHARE REPURCHASE ACTIVITY

    During the quarter, the Company repurchased 631,000 shares of
common stock bringing the cumulative total shares repurchased under
the current share repurchase program to approximately 3.5 million
shares. At the end of the second quarter, the remaining balance of
shares authorized for repurchase under the program was approximately
1.5 million shares.

    AptarGroup, Inc. is a leading global supplier of a broad range of
innovative dispensing systems for the fragrance/cosmetic, personal
care, pharmaceutical, household and food/beverage markets. AptarGroup
is headquartered in Crystal Lake, Illinois, with manufacturing
facilities in North America, Europe, Asia and South America. For more
